'''Day One/Scene Two (The Towers)'''
 
'''Day One/Scene Two (The Towers)'''
  
The team arrive at Dell Street in the Towers, where Dave Kline's apartment is located in the Cypress Heights building. They discover two armoured police vehicles are parked outside the building. They split up in order to try differing approaches to gain entrance to the building and to also gain more information about what is going on.

Adam, in his role as a doctor, talks his way into the lobby where he discovers a small group of police standing around the body of a security guard. The guard (Mikhail Clarke) had had his cervical vertebra shattered with a brunt broad object. Whoever did it was very fast or took the guard by surprise, since his shotgun was halfway out of its holster.
